页面导航: 首页网络编程JavaScript应用技巧 → 正文内容

用javascript实现li 列表数据隔行变换背景颜色

发布:dxy 字体:[增加 减小] 类型:转载
又是客户端效果,效率自然不错。以前的做法是偶数行时给li加一个class,笨笨~
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N">
<HTML>
<HEAD>
<TITLE> New Document </TITLE>
<META NAME="Generator" CONTENT="EditPlus">
<META NAME="Author" CONTENT="">
<META NAME="Keywords" CONTENT="">
<META NAME="Description" CONTENT="">
<style type="text/css">
<!--
.li01 { background:#FFF; }
.li02 { background:#eeeeee; }
-->
</style>
</HEAD>
<BODY>
<div ><ul id="list01">
<li class="title"><a href="#">title</a></li> 
<li><a href="#">111</a></li> 
<li><a href="#">222</a></li>
<li><a href="#">333</a></li>
<li><a href="#">444</a></li>
<li><a href="#">555</a></li>
<li><a href="#">666</a></li>
</ul></div>
<script Language="Javascript">
objName=document.getElementById("list01").getElementsByTagName("li")
for (i=0;i<objName.length;i++) {
(i%2==0)?(objName(i).className = "li01"):(objName(i).className = "li02");
}
</script>
</BODY>
</HTML>
浏览次数:载入中... 打印本文关闭本文返回首页

文章评论

共有 位脚本之家网友发表了评论我来说两句

同 类 文 章
最 近 更 新
热 点 排 行